Pilz is one of just a few companies on the market that's now authorised to CE mark its own products that fall under the scope of Annex IV of the Machinery Directive 2006/42/EC. The prerequisite is a comprehensive quality management system, which has been certificed by a notified body in accordance with Annex X of the Machinery Directive. Not only does this incorporate manufacture, final inspection and testing but also product design and development, so it goes well beyond the usual requirements of DIN EN ISO 9001.
TÜV Süd tested the Pilz quality management system, including all development and production processes, and certified it in April 2010. Once again this underlines Pilz's competence as a leading safety technology company.
The certificate covers the following Pilz product groups in particular:
- Protective devices designed to detect the presence of persons
- Power-operated interlocking movable guards designed to be used as safeguards in machinery and
- Logic units to ensure safety functions
